The Ada Resource Association
AdaCore Announces New GPS Version
GNAT Programming Studio Includes
Improved Navigation and Interface

NEW YORK, NY, and PARIS [Jan. 24, 2006]--ARA member AdaCore, an international developer of Ada tools and compilers, has introduced a new version of its GNAT Programming Studio (GPS), a sophisticated software development environment for the Ada programming language.
Incorporating a significant number of new features, the new GPS version includes improved usability and more powerful source navigation, according to the company's press release. It is available on the latest 64 bit GNU/Linux-based platforms, including those from SGI, HP and Intel.
The company concentrated on a more user-friendly location view, enhanced tool tips, code completion, and new project-editing capabilities. Human interface improvements include better layout of graphical information, as well as the ability to export using the Scalable Vector Graphics format.
GPS offers multi-language support, including Ada, C, and C++, and is available on a wide range of host environments for both native and cross-development, including UNIX, Windows and GNU/Linux. An intuitive, unified visual interface, identical across all platforms, serves as a control panel to access tools from AdaCore’s GNAT Pro Ada development environment as well as from third parties, easing both development and maintenance. As a result, GPS is particularly suited for large, complex systems requiring tool chain integration, ease of use, user customization, and code navigation/analysis.
The latest version of GPS provides many new features, including:
  • New availability on IA-64 SGI Altix, IA-64 HP Linux, IA-64 HP-UX, x86-64 GNU/Linux platforms
  • New cross-reference queries
  • Improved plug-in capabilities and python extensions
  • Refactoring (rename entity, named parameter associations)
  • More efficient and user-friendly locations view
  • Improved assembly view
  • Persistent bookmarks
  • Version Control System activities (group commit)
  • Enhanced tooltips and code completion
  • Improved graphs (better layout, ability to export in SVG format)
  • New call graph tree
  • Project Editor enhancements

About GPS

GPS is an Integrated Development Environment (IDE) written in Ada, based on the GtkAda toolkit. GPS’ extensive source-code navigation and analysis tools can generate a broad range of useful information, including call graphs, source dependencies, project organization, and complexity metrics. It also provides support for configuration management through an interface to third-party Version Control Systems, and supports a variety of platforms, including Alpha Tru64, Altix Linux, MIPS-IRIX, PA-RISC HP-UX, SPARC Solaris, x86 GNU/Linux, x86 Solaris, and x86 Windows. GPS is highly extensible; a simple scripting approach enables additional tool integration. It is also tailorable, allowing programmers to specialize various aspects of the program’s appearance in the editor for a user-specified look and feel.

About the ARA

The Ada Resource Association (http://www.adaresource.com) is an international trade group comprising the principal vendors of Ada-related technology. The ARA promotes and publicizes Ada technology usage (http://www.adaic.org), and sponsors the ongoing development and maintenance of the Ada language standard and associated infrastructure.
The ARA's current members are AdaCore, Aonix, IBM Rational, Praxis Critical Systems, and SofCheck.
# # #
Sponsored by the following ARA member companies:
ARA Members AdaCore Praxis Critical Systems IBM Rational Sofcheck
 
Valid HTML 4.01! Valid CSS!